With the technology and science making the progress,the continuous developmentoftechnology, more and more people are aware of the benefits of in situstress measurementinengineering. Stressmeasurement plays an important role on the engineering safety andsaving resources, it also has now become a major research to pic in mines in china.The main content of this paperis to study the hydraulic fracturing method for someproblems in engineering application, including the traditionalhy draulic pressure crackmeasured on the test section contains a primary crack method,though the analysis todetermine whether there is acrack in the test section of the measured data to estimate thereliability ofthe test results.Then,making use of analysis of the principle of hydraulicfracturing crack method,find out the causes of errors,and using the method of inversionprocedure and using genetic algorithm to find the optimal solution. Showing theexplanation of the common problems about how to confirm fracturing parameters.exposingthat how to choose the date by some examples.For the measurement of the verticalstressof the estimation of reliability problems bymeans of statistics and summarizes the general rules to determine,according to the weightof the overlying rockto estimatefor ageneral discriminant method.The3D hydraulicfracturing method,explained the measurement principle of hydraulic fracturecriterion andfracture pattern recognition problems and gives the solutions.The interpretation method ofhydraulic fracturing method,this paper introduces the principle of each method,andaccording to its principle,the reliability analysis ofthe measurement data of the scope of ageneral judgment.On how to deal with the problems about the system flexibility,thiscontradiction,we first propose to the third chapteris a detailed explanation.Discussed theinfluence to the circumstances in the flexibility of the system is relatively large.And for itsimpact on the correction.
